Kate Beckinsale is mourning the loss of her stepfather.
On Monday, the Underworld actress painfully confirmed to her Instagram followers that her stepfather Roy Battersby, who’s best known for directing British TV shows like Between the Lines, Cracker, and Inspector Morse, has sadly passed away at the age of 87.

Joe Otterson TV Reporter Taylor Sheridan‘s upcoming Paramount+ series “Land Man” has added four new series regulars, Variety has learned exclusively. Kayla Wallace (“When Calls The Heart”), frequent Sheridan collaborator James Jordan (“Yellowstone”) Mark Collie (“Nashville”) and Paulina Chávez (“The Expanding Universe of Ashley Garcia”) have all joined the series alongside previously announced lead Billy Bob Thornton and fellow series regulars Ali Larter, Michelle Randolph and Jacob Lofland.

Rebecca Rubin Film and Media Reporter Netflix has scrapped the release of “The Mothership,” a science-fiction film starring Halle Berry. The movie finished filming in 2021, but it couldn’t be completed after multiple delays in post-production, Variety has confirmed. “The Mothership” is the latest Hollywood movie to disappear even though filming had wrapped.

Kate Beckinsale attended the Golden Globes as a presenter, then hit the Netflix party. But she ended her night in a hospital, where her stepfather, TV director Roy Battersby, is recovering from a stroke.
